Greek Yogurt and Berry Parfait Recipe
Ingredients (serves 2)
- 1 cup Greek yogurt (plain or vanilla-flavored)
- 1 cup mixed berries (blueberries, strawberries, raspberries, or your choice)
- 1/4 cup granola (or muesli for a healthier option)
- 1–2 tsp honey or maple syrup (optional, for sweetness)
- 1 tbsp chopped nuts (like almonds or walnuts)
- 1 tsp chia seeds (optional, for extra nutrition)
Instructions
- 1. Prep the Ingredients 🫐
Start by giving your berries a nice wash under cold water to remove any dirt or residue, then gently pat them dry with a clean towel. If you’re using strawberries, slice them into bite-sized pieces. I recommend preparing everything in advance—this includes measuring out the Greek yogurt, granola, and your favorite toppings. - 2. Sweeten the Yogurt (Optional) 🍯
Now, here’s a little tip if you’re someone who likes a sweeter twist to your parfait. Take your Greek yogurt and stir in a teaspoon or two of honey or maple syrup. Don’t overdo it—just enough to complement the tangy flavor of the yogurt. Personally, I love using honey because it adds a natural, floral sweetness. 3. Start Layering in Style 🌈
Choose a clear glass or jar—it makes the parfait look so much more appealing because you can see all the beautiful layers! Begin by adding 2–3 tablespoons of Greek yogurt as the base. Next, sprinkle on a layer of granola to add that satisfying crunch. Then, create a vibrant layer of mixed berries. Pro tip: Press the berries gently against the side of the glass for that “wow” factor when you look at the layers. Repeat this process until your glass is full, leaving just a little space at the top for your final toppings.
4. Add Toppings to Elevate Your Parfait ✨
Now for the fun part—toppings! Sprinkle on some chopped nuts for texture (I love almonds or walnuts), a few chia seeds for added nutrition, and maybe even a light drizzle of honey for that glossy finish. If you’re feeling creative, garnish with a sprig of fresh mint or a dusting of coconut flakes. These little touches make the parfait feel fancy and elevate the overall flavor and presentation. - 5. Serve and Enjoy Fresh 🍓
The key to enjoying the perfect parfait is serving it right away. The granola stays wonderfully crunchy, the berries remain fresh and juicy, and the yogurt keeps its creamy texture. 🔖 Tips!
- Make it ahead: Prepare the layers in advance (minus the granola) and store in the fridge. Add granola just before serving to keep it crunchy.
- Substitutions: Swap granola for crushed biscuits or oats for a unique twist. You can also use plant-based yogurt for a vegan version.
- Seasonal fruits: Try mango, kiwi, or peaches when berries aren’t in season.

How to Plate and Design a Stunning Parfait
Making a Greek Yogurt and Berry Parfait isn’t just about taste—it’s also about creating a visually appealing dish that’s almost too beautiful to eat. Here are some tips to help you elevate your parfait presentation: 🍨✨
1. Choose the Right Glassware
- Opt for clear, tall glasses or jars to highlight the layers. Martini glasses, mason jars, or even small wine glasses work well.
- For a more modern look, try asymmetrical or geometric glassware.
Why It Matters: Clear glass allows the vibrant colors of the berries, creamy yogurt, and crunchy granola to shine, creating a layered masterpiece that draws the eye.
2. Keep the Layers Neat and Even
- Use a spoon or piping bag to carefully add each layer, ensuring the yogurt doesn’t smear the sides of the glass.
- For a sharp contrast, press the berries lightly against the inner wall of the glass as you add them.
Pro Tip: Alternate smaller and larger berries (e.g., blueberries with raspberries) to create texture and variety in the layers.
3. Add a Pop of Color on Top
Finish with bright garnishes like:
- A sprig of fresh mint 🌿
- Shaved dark chocolate 🍫
- Edible flowers 🌸 (like violets or pansies)
- Thin slices of kiwi or dragon fruit for an exotic touch 🥝
4. Play with Textures
- For a crunchy contrast, sprinkle toasted coconut flakes or crushed nuts as a topping.
- Add chia seeds or a drizzle of honey for extra sparkle and nutrition.
- A dusting of powdered sugar over the berries adds a touch of elegance.
5. Layer with a Theme in Mind
- Monochromatic Look: Use berries of the same color family (e.g., just blueberries and blackberries) for a minimalist aesthetic.
- Rainbow Vibes: Layer fruits in a rainbow order for a cheerful, colorful parfait.
- Seasonal Design: Incorporate fruits and garnishes that reflect the season (e.g., cranberries and cinnamon for winter, peaches and mint for summer).
6. Use Props for Serving
- Place the glass on a decorative plate and surround it with fresh berries or granola as accents.
- Use small serving spoons with unique handles for an extra touch of sophistication.
Bonus Tip: For a rustic vibe, tie a piece of twine around the jar, or serve the parfait on a wooden board.

Greek Yogurt and Berry Parfait
Equipment
- 1 Clear glass or jar
- 1 Mixing bowls
- 1 Measuring spoons and cups
- 1 Knife and chopping board
- 1 Spoon or small ladle
- 1 Optional: Tweezers or small tongs for precise layering
Ingredients
- 1 cup Greek yogurt (unsweetened)
- 1-2 tbsp honey or maple syrup (optional for sweetness)
- 1/2 cup mixed berries (blueberries, raspberries, strawberries, etc.)
- 1/4 cup granola
- 1 tsp chia seeds (optional)
- 1-2 tbsp chopped nuts (e.g., almonds, walnuts)
- Fresh mint or coconut flakes (for garnish, optional)
Instructions
- Prep the Ingredients: Wash and dry your berries thoroughly. Slice the strawberries into bite-sized pieces. Prepare all ingredients in advance for an efficient layering process.
- Sweeten the Yogurt (Optional): If you prefer a sweeter parfait, stir in honey or maple syrup to the Greek yogurt. Adjust the sweetness according to your taste.
- Start Layering: In a clear glass or jar, layer 2–3 tablespoons of Greek yogurt at the base. Follow with a layer of granola and a layer of mixed berries. Repeat until the glass is filled.
- Add Toppings: Add your choice of chopped nuts, chia seeds, and drizzle with extra honey for a glossy finish. Garnish with fresh mint or coconut flakes for an elegant touch.
- Serve Immediately: Serve your parfait fresh, with crunchy granola and juicy berries, ready to be enjoyed as a wholesome breakfast or snack!
